Optimal Proportion Selection Of Nutrient Solution And Quality Adjustment Of Hydroponic Lettuce

Plant Factory is a kind of efficient agricultural production method,which relys on modern high-tech agricultural facilities and cultivation techniques.It has high Land productivity, high labor productivity and economic benefits,achieving a balanced annual production of vegetables and other agricultural products, has already become the important means of developing modern agriculture. Hydroponics plant is the leading cultivation techniques of the Plant factory, nutrition nutrient ratio determines the yield and quality of vegetables.Study the influence of different NPK ratio and concentration on growth of hydroponic lettuce, it has important scientific significance and application value for optimal management of the lettuce, reaching the aims of high yield, high quality, low cost production. Chosing the Hong Kong glass brittle leaf lettuce as experiment material,adopted the deep hydroponic method,studied the effects of different concentration of NPK and nutrient solution on hydroponic lettuce growth,quality and the mineral dynamic absorption.(1) When the nitrogen level was 6 mmol·L-1,lettuce can obtain maximum yield,and higher nitrogen levels improved the lettuce quality;Different nitrogen concentration significantly affected the lettuce nitrogen absorption,as nitrogen level increased, phosphorus,potassium,calcium and magnesium absorption efficiency increased first and then decreased,and the nitrogen utilization efficiency linear decreased. (2) When phosphorus level was 0.6 mmol·L-1,lettuce yield gained maximum;and when was 0.4 mmol·L-1,the lettuce quality was the best;as phosphorus level increasing, nitrogen uptake of lettuce had no significant difference,while the phosphorus uptake continually increased,and uptake of potassium reached the peak in the 10 d before harvest,the absorption of calcium,magnesium didn’t change significantly in the whole growth period. (3) When the concentration of potassium level was 3 mmol·L-1,lettuce yield got to the maximum;and when was 4 mmol·L-1,the comprehensive quality of lettuce was best; nitrogen and phosphorus absorption gained the maximum in the 20-30 d after plantpotassium uptake increased as the potassium level increasing,the calcium and magnesium absorption were uniform in the whole growth stage.(4)Relative to the not replacement,the treatment of replacement markedly improved the yield and quality of the lettuce,while the NPK level almost kept the same as the treatment of unchanged nutrient solution when the lettuce yield and quality gained the maximum,the yield difference was not significant,the mineral elements uptake obviously increased,and 30-40 d mineral elements uptake increases continuously.(5) In the quality-control tests of changing the concentration of the nutrient solution at the last of the growth,as the concentration increased,the yield increasd accordingly,and reached the maximum in the 2 times fomula;when the concentration was 0 times,the lettuce gained the lowest nitrate,highest vitamin C and soluble sugar,when the concentration was 0.5 times,the lettuce gained the highest soluble protein,Chlorophyll a and Chlorophyll b.(6) In the quality-control tests of changing the concentration of the nutrient solution at the last of the growth,the sequence stages which influenced the lettuce yield were 30~40 d、20-30d、0-20d after planting,at last,got the optimization of production plan,that was in the stage of 30~40 d,20~30 d,0~20 d,the corresponding nutrient solution was ltimes,ltimes,ltimes,orl times,0.75 times,0.5 times.
